Traditional and Discreet Options
The classic choice for many remains the durable and highly effective metal braces. These consist of small brackets adhered to the front surface of your teeth, linked by a thin wire and secured with tiny elastic bands. Their primary strength lies in their robustness and their proven ability to correct even the most complex misalignments efficiently. Many individuals opt for this method due to its reliability and effectiveness. However, for some, the conspicuous appearance of these appliances can be a concern.
As a more aesthetically pleasing alternative, ceramic braces present a compelling option. These utilize brackets made from tooth-colored materials, allowing them to blend more seamlessly with your natural dentition. While they offer a less visible appearance compared to their metal counterparts, they may sometimes be more susceptible to chipping and might necessitate a slightly more careful approach during daily care. For those prioritizing near invisibility, lingual braces are affixed to the back of the teeth, rendering them completely hidden from view. This offers excellent aesthetic benefits, though they can occasionally affect speech patterns and may be more complex to clean and adjust, potentially influencing the overall expense.
Beyond these fixed appliances, removable clear aligners, like those offered by Braces & Invisalign: Top Teeth Alignment Solutions, provide another popular path to a straighter smile. This system involves a series of custom-made trays that gradually shift teeth into their desired positions. Their primary advantage is their removability, allowing for easier eating and cleaning. Furthermore, their transparency makes them exceptionally discreet. However, consistent wear is paramount for success, and they may not be suitable for correcting very severe orthodontic issues. Invisalign Clear Aligners: How They Work
Invisalign has revolutionized the landscape of orthodontic correction, offering a discreet and effective alternative to traditional methods. Unlike conventional braces that involve metal brackets and wires, invisalign utilizes a series of custom-made, virtually invisible clear aligners. These aligners are meticulously crafted from a smooth, comfortable, and durable thermoplastic material, designed to fit snugly over your teeth. This innovative approach makes them a highly sought-after solution for individuals seeking to straighten their smiles without drawing attention to their dental work.
The Custom Treatment Journey
The journey with invisalign begins with a comprehensive consultation with your dental professional. During this initial appointment, they will assess your specific orthodontic needs and goals. A crucial step involves creating a precise digital scan of your teeth. This advanced technology generates a detailed 3D model, which serves as the foundation for your personalized treatment plan. Using this digital blueprint, a series of custom-made aligners are manufactured. Each set of these clear aligners for teeth straightening is engineered to apply gentle pressure to specific teeth, guiding them incrementally toward their desired position. You will typically wear each set of aligners for approximately one to two weeks before progressing to the next set in the series. This progressive movement ensures a comfortable and gradual transformation of your smile.
Convenience and Effectiveness
One of the most significant advantages of this system is its removability. Unlike fixed appliances, the clear aligners for teeth straightening can be easily removed by the wearer. This means you can continue to eat your favorite foods, drink beverages without restriction, and maintain your regular oral hygiene routine of brushing and flossing with ease. This convenience is a major draw for many adults who desire to improve their smile's appearance without disrupting their daily lives. For optimal and timely results, it is essential to wear the aligners for 20 to 22 hours per day, only removing them for eating, drinking, and cleaning. This commitment ensures that the progressive adjustments happen as planned, leading to a beautifully straightened smile over the course of your treatment. Orthodontic Treatment Duration: How Long Does Invisalign Take?
One of the most frequent inquiries from individuals considering discreet smile correction is regarding the timeframe involved. Specifically, many want to know, "How long does Invisalign take?" While a definitive answer depends on individual circumstances, most adult patients find their journey with invisalign treatment typically spans between 6 to 18 months. However, for less complex dental alignment needs, the process can sometimes be completed in as little as 3 to 6 months.
Several pivotal factors influence this duration. The complexity of your specific dental issues plays a significant role; extensive tooth crowding, significant spacing between teeth, or more involved bite discrepancies will naturally require a longer treatment period compared to minor adjustments. Crucially, patient compliance is paramount. Consistent wear of the custom-made aligners for 20-22 hours per day is essential to ensure the teeth move as planned and the treatment stays on schedule. Failure to adhere to this wearing schedule can prolong the overall treatment time.
Factors Influencing Treatment Length
Beyond the complexity of the case and patient adherence, other variables contribute to the total duration of smile transformation. Individual biological responses to tooth movement can vary, meaning some people's teeth shift more readily than others. The precise goals set by your orthodontist for achieving your ideal smile also factor into the treatment plan's length. Furthermore, the specific strategy employed by your dental professional, including the number of aligner sets prescribed and the frequency of check-ups, will impact the timeline. Regular follow-up appointments are vital for monitoring progress, assessing the fit of the aligners, and making any necessary refinements to the treatment plan, ensuring everything progresses efficiently towards your desired outcome.

Retainer Cost and Types After Treatment
Once your journey to a beautifully aligned smile concludes, the diligent use of retainers becomes paramount. These crucial devices are designed to hold your teeth in their newly acquired positions, preventing them from shifting back towards their original alignment. Skipping this vital post-treatment phase can unfortunately reverse the progress achieved through your orthodontic intervention. Understanding Retainer Options
Several types of retainers are available, each offering a unique approach to maintaining your smile. Fixed retainers, often referred to as bonded retainers, are a permanent solution. They consist of a thin wire meticulously bonded to the back surfaces of your front teeth, providing continuous, passive support. While highly effective in preventing relapse, they may require more meticulous cleaning practices to maintain optimal oral hygiene. In contrast, removable retainers offer greater flexibility. These include the traditional Hawley retainers, characterized by their custom-molded acrylic base and wire components that gently hold the teeth in place. Another popular option is the clear retainer, which closely resembles the aesthetic of invisalign aligners. These are often favoured for their discreet appearance and enhanced comfort during wear, making the transition to retention feel seamless after undergoing treatments similar to those using clear aligners for teeth straightening.
Choosing the Right Retainer
The decision between different retainer options often hinges on individual needs, lifestyle, and professional recommendations. Fixed retainers offer unwavering stability, ideal for patients who may not be diligent with removable appliances. However, for those prioritizing aesthetics and ease of use, removable clear retainers or Hawley appliances are excellent choices. The lifespan of removable retainers can vary, and they may require periodic replacement, whereas fixed retainers are a one-time placement, though they may need adjustments or repairs. Both types play an indispensable role in preserving the results of your dental work, whether it involved traditional braces or a series of clear aligners.
